Pestfriedhof
Pestfriedhof is a forest in Dippoldiswalde, Sächsische Schweiz-Osterzgebirge, Saxony. Pestfriedhof is situated nearby to the village Obercarsdorf, as well as near Sadisdorf.Places of Interest

Schmiedeberg is a village and a former municipality in the Sächsische Schweiz-Osterzgebirge district, in Saxony, Germany. It is situated in the valley of the river Rote Weißeritz, 24 km south of Dresden.
